当我做资产时,Uglifycss错误:转储

时间:2018-04-18 14:01:47

标签: symfony uglifycss

当我尝试在Symfony上执行<div class="outside"> <div class="container"> <div class="photo"></div> <div class="bottom"></div> </div> </div>时,我得到以下异常:

php app/console assetic:dump --env=prod

我使用uglify-js和uglifycss。当它执行js时它做得很好,但当它到达css时它会给我以前的错误。只有当我在 [Assetic\Exception\FilterException] An error occurred while running: '/usr/bin/nodejs' '/usr/local/bin/uglifycss' '/tmp/assetic_uglifycssv74yv7' Error Output: /usr/local/lib/node_modules/uglifycss/uglifycss:29 const { defaultOptions, processString, processFiles } = require('./') ^ SyntaxError: Unexpected token { at Module._compile (module.js:439:25) at Object.Module._extensions..js (module.js:474:10) at Module.load (module.js:356:32) at Function.Module._load (module.js:312:12) at Function.Module.runMain (module.js:497:10) at startup (node.js:119:16) at node.js:906:3 上执行命令时才会发生这种情况。我不知道还能做什么。

谢谢!

1 个答案:

答案 0 :(得分:0)

我有一个非常旧的节点版本,升级到版本9修复了错误。